Parque Urbano Nicolândia is an amusement park located within the Sarah Kubitschek City Park in Brasília. The park features a variety of mechanical rides, including roller coasters and a Ferris wheel. It serves as a central recreational hub for residents of the Federal District. The site occupies a significant portion of the city's primary urban green space. Visitors can find various food kiosks and snack bars distributed throughout the grounds. The park facilities cater to different age groups, ranging from children's attractions to high-intensity thrill rides. It operates as an outdoor venue integrated into the local landscape design of the capital.
The top of the Ferris wheel offers a clear view of the park grounds and the surrounding Brasília skyline.
